Skip to commentsAndrew McGinn and David Neitzke have published their first graphic novel, “The Legacy – a Graphic Novel.” For those who are sensitive to critique of the American newspaper comic strip, this book probably best be avoided. John Hogan over at Graphic Novel Reporter describes it as, “about a young man named Chas who inherits a comic strip from his father?and does his level best to lose it as fast as he can. Try as he might, though (and he certainly tries), he just can?t seem to get rid of it, which makes for some very entertaining reading and a biting satire of the world of comic strips.” (Check out Graphicnovelreporter.com for an interview with the creators)
